Output dbbdfe39b745c4c56697dbff117575eef35db2e9512d17b7fe638b91302fc033:6

value
681999
script pubkey
OP_0 OP_PUSHBYTES_20 8800bb39736cc366fc1741a4ed9962e66c82a910
address
bc1q3qqtkwtndnpkdlqhgxjwmxtzuekg92gsat6n84
transaction
dbbdfe39b745c4c56697dbff117575eef35db2e9512d17b7fe638b91302fc033
confirmations
168093
spent
true